[PATCH v3 3/3] cpupower: do not count incomplete topology entries as physical cores

The physical core count is derived by sorting core_info by core_cpu_list
and counting how many distinct lists there are. The loop seeds the count
with entry 0 unconditionally:
last_cpu_list = cpu_top->core_info[0].core_cpu_list;
cpu_top->cores = 1;
A CPU whose topology could not be read is still a member of the array,
carrying pkg and core of -1 and a core_cpu_list of "-1". That sorts ahead
of any real cpu list, so after the qsort it is entry 0 and it seeds the
count as if it were a core. The pkg check inside the loop only guards the
entries that follow, never the one the count started from.
An offline CPU is enough to reach this. The topology attribute group is
added and removed by a CPU hotplug callback in drivers/base/topology.c, so
physical_package_id and core_id are absent while a CPU is offline and both
reads fail.
Skip entries without complete topology data and count from zero, so only
CPUs with a package and a core contribute.

@@ -212,11 +212,16 @@ int get_cpu_topology(struct cpupower_topology *cpu_top)
qsort(cpu_top->core_info, cpus, sizeof(struct cpuid_core_info),
__compare_core_cpu_list);
- last_cpu_list = cpu_top->core_info[0].core_cpu_list;
- cpu_top->cores = 1;
- for (cpu = 1; cpu < cpus; cpu++) {
- if (strcmp(cpu_top->core_info[cpu].core_cpu_list, last_cpu_list) != 0 &&
- cpu_top->core_info[cpu].pkg != -1) {
+ last_cpu_list = NULL;
+ cpu_top->cores = 0;
+ for (cpu = 0; cpu < cpus; cpu++) {
+ if (cpu_top->core_info[cpu].pkg == -1 ||
+ cpu_top->core_info[cpu].core == -1)
+ continue;
+
+ if (!last_cpu_list ||
+ strcmp(cpu_top->core_info[cpu].core_cpu_list,
+ last_cpu_list) != 0) {
last_cpu_list = cpu_top->core_info[cpu].core_cpu_list;
cpu_top->cores++;
}
